×

Inverse sliding-window filters for vision-aided inertial navigation systems

  • US 9,658,070 B2
  • Filed: 07/10/2015
  • Issued: 05/23/2017
  • Est. Priority Date: 07/11/2014
  • Status: Active Grant
First Claim
Patent Images

1. A vision-aided inertial navigation system comprising:

  • at least one image source to produce image data along a trajectory of the vision-aided inertial navigation system (VINS) within an environment, wherein the image data contains a plurality of features observed within the environment at a plurality of poses of the VINS along the trajectory;

    an inertial measurement unit (IMU) to produce IMU data indicative of motion of the vision-aided inertial navigation system; and

    a hardware-based processing unit comprising an estimator that determines, based on the image data and the IMU data, estimates for at least a position and orientation of the vision-aided inertial navigation system for a plurality of poses of the VINS along the trajectory,wherein the estimator determines the estimates by;

    classifying, for each of the poses, each of the features observed at the respective pose into either a first set of the features or a second set of the features,maintaining a state vector having states for a position and orientation of the VINS and for positions with the environment for the first set of features for a sliding window of two or more of the most recent poses along the trajectory without maintaining states for positions of the second set of features within the state vector, andapplying an inverse sliding window filter to compute constraints between the poses within the sliding window based on the second set of features and compute, in accordance with the constraints, the state estimates within the state vector for the sliding window.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×